Agua Caliente is a water park in Guadalajara, located at Km 58 on Carretera a Barra de Navidad, it is around a half hour outside of town. The water park includes wave pool, water slides and restaurants. Playground,Tennis Courts, and entertainment from the peaceful to the most thrilling. The Chapala Country Club nestled in the mountains is a semi-private country club, offering a challenging 9 holes golf course with beautiful surroundings.Built along the side of a mountain, with incredible views of Lake Chapala. There are regular golfing group activities 6 days per week. Open Hours are 7:30 a.m. to dusk. Part of Guadalajara‘s appeal is that it has many of the attractions of Mexico City – a vibrant culture, great museums, exciting nightlife and good places to stay and eat – but few of the capital’s problems. Guadalajara is bright, modern, well organized and unpolluted. Visitors can always find interesting things to do. Guadalajara’s distinctive mix of modernity and tradition make it an ideal destination for living, studying or just visiting. There are a number of excellent restaurants,including the one with the worlds fastest service. Don’t miss the dolphin and seal show at the Guadalajara Zoo. On weekends, you can explore nearby tourist destinations such as Puerto Vallarta, Tequila, and Guanajuato.
